If you are a private school principal … know the requirements for advertising for a private public education institution?

The Ministry of Education has set 6 requirements for the adoption of a public education institution in the emirates of “Ajman, Umm Al Quwain, Fujairah and Ras Al Khaimah”, where it works under the supervision and follow -up of the ministry.
Prior approval
The Emirates Today monitored through the official website of the Ministry of Education, the details of the service of “requesting the adoption of a private public education announcement”, which allows private educational institutions licensed by the ministry to apply for prior approval to publish their ads through various media, within clear organizational controls aimed at controlling media content related to the educational sector, and ensuring its compatibility with legal and professional standards.
Institutional identity
According to what was stated on the official website, the ministry requires that the announcement not include the name or slogan of the ministry, in any formula, in order to preserve the institutional identity and to prevent any use that may suggest a direct official association with the content of the advertising. The educational institution is also required to attach a copy of the advertisement to be approved in PDF format, provided that the file size does not exceed 2 MB per document.
Clear approvals
The published conditions also stipulate the necessity of obtaining clear approvals from the rights holders related to the advertisement, and the approval of the parents includes in the event that the advertisement includes pictures of students, the approval of the persons apparent in the advertisement, if the pictures are for individuals who are not students, and the approval of the owner of the pictures or the materials used, in the event that the pictures are taken from websites or other institutions.
Protecting rights
These controls confirm the Ministry’s keenness to protect the rights of individuals and institutions, and to preserve the privacy of students and participants in media materials, as well as ensuring the commitment of educational institutions to vocational publishing rules and respect for intellectual property.
The organization of the relationship
This service also represents part of the Ministry’s efforts to organize the media relationship between educational institutions and the public, and to ensure that the published ads reflect a positive and disciplined image of the private educational sector in the country.
Detailed conditions
With this service, private schools that work under the supervision of the Ministry should refer to the official website of “Education” and see the detailed conditions related to this service, before proceeding to prepare or publish any advertising or promotional materials, to avoid delay or rejecting the request due to the lack of fulfillment of the requirements.
